Responsibilities
Ensure the complete reception of all documentation and files needed to assemble the product (Bill of Materials, CAD and gerber data, XYRS, ECO, drawings, assembly procedures, etc.)
Read and interpret drawings, schematics and datasheets
Research engineering related problems that are submitted by employees, customers, engineering, sales, receiving, and purchasing. Ability to analyze data and situation and come up with creative solutions
Identify and resolve engineering related issues that affect the manufacturability of the product (incorrect CAD and gerber files, BOM and XYRS discrepancies, polarity/orientation questions, components that do not fit the pads on the PCB, assembly instruction verification, component package issues, incorrect stencil, etc)
Interact with customers for follow-up via phone and email in various phases of production. Able to showcase thorough follow up to prevent delays
Maintain a complete and accurate component library that is used to create the Bill of Materials (BOM). Make additions and corrections to components based on input from datasheets, production work center, and customer feedback. This system must be in sync with the pick & place machines component library
Correct BOM discrepancies as reported by customers and other departments
Collaborate with production. Perform pre-assembly job review on all incoming data sets. Work directly with customer on solving design or assembly issues prior to manufacturing
